FACILITIES TICKET — Marrowgate Site
Subject: Shuttle-bus gate, north car park

New starters: the shuttle-bus gate by the north car park is card-controlled. Your staff badge will not work until day three of onboarding. Until then, use the pedestrian side gate. The shuttle departs every 20 minutes from 07:00. Do not tailgate through the vehicle barrier; it closes fast. If the reader rejects your badge, use the temporary gate code below.

staff pass of kawip-hawef = bdg-QLP-2

## Shuttle-Bus Gate — Onboarding Note

The Petrel Point shuttle enters via Gate C on Wrenfield Road. Facilities desk staff raise the barrier for the 07:40 and 17:55 runs; the driver handles all other times. Log each manual lift in the gate sheet. If the intercom fails, open the keypad housing and enter the code below.

door code, yagap-bahof: bdg-O-05

# Second-Source Supplier Search — Restricted to Managers

Following repeated delays from our sole resin supplier, Marnwell Polymers, procurement has begun qualifying alternates in the Kestrel Valley region. Branch managers should document any local candidates carefully, including capacity, certifications, and lead times, and submit assessments through the Orvane portal by month-end. Treat all vendor discussions as sensitive. Context for this urgency appears in the note below.

board note of baweg-bawig: Project Tamath slips by six weeks because of the audit delay.